Off-site run — item 4: Crate of survey instruments (theodolite, two levelers, tripod set) for the Brackwell ridge survey. Confirm foam inserts are seated and the humidity card reads green before sealing. Crate goes to the Fennick Surveying depot desk only, not reception. Release the crate only after the courier states this phrase:

dispatch memo: the sorox briiel courier leaves the druius kelion fenir gorvan ralael rusius julwyn belwyn ledger at gate 4220 under passcode 637242

Runbook: ParityScope rate-parity checker (Quillhaven Hospitality). Before promoting a release, confirm the comparison engine has ingested the latest channel snapshots from the Larkspur feed and that mismatch alerts are below the 2% threshold on staging. If the scraper pool shows stale workers, recycle them via the dashboard rather than restarting the whole service. Once the smoke suite passes, record the promotion in the ledger. The token for this promotion appears below.

trace token, fafog-kageg: htk4_98e6

Ticket: PoolGate exhausts connections under moderate load on Brixa staging. Symptoms: timeouts after ~40 concurrent requests, idle connections never reclaimed. Suspected cause: leak in the retry wrapper holding handles across failed transactions. Workaround: lower max pool size to 20 and restart nightly. New folks: reproduce locally with the loadgen script first. Attach the build token printed beneath this line to any repro report.

build token for kagaf-hahof: htk14_9d3d4d26d7d8de

FACILITIES TICKET — First-Aid Room, Marwick Building, Level 3

Priority: Medium. Raised by the assistants' pool after Tuesday's incident review.

The first-aid room door closer is slamming too hard and the interior light flickers. Please schedule repair outside core hours (09:00–17:30) so the room remains available. Supplies cabinet was restocked last week; no action needed there. Contractors attending must sign in at the Level 3 desk and be escorted. For access during the repair window, team assistants should use the temporary door code below.

door code, kawip-bagap: bdg-HQEWH-4